Press

0.2.0-ci0014

A Continuous Deployment Environment for building Powershell Modules and Scripts

Minimum PowerShell version

2.0.0

This is a prerelease version of Press.
There is a newer prerelease version of this module available.
See the version list below for details.
The owner has unlisted this package. This could mean that the module is deprecated or shouldn't be used anymore.

Installation Options

Copy and Paste the following command to install this package using PowerShellGet More Info

Install-Module -Name Press -RequiredVersion 0.2.0-ci0014 -AllowPrerelease

Copy and Paste the following command to install this package using Microsoft.PowerShell.PSResourceGet More Info

Install-PSResource -Name Press -Version 0.2.0-ci0014 -Prerelease

You can deploy this package directly to Azure Automation. Note that deploying packages with dependencies will deploy all the dependencies to Azure Automation. Learn More

Manually download the .nupkg file to your system's default download location. Note that the file won't be unpacked, and won't include any dependencies. Learn More

Owners

Copyright

Copyright 2021 Justin Grote, All Rights Reserved. Released under the MIT license

Package Details

Author(s)

  • Justin Grote

Functions

Build-ReleaseNotes Compress-Module Copy-ModuleFiles Get-PublicFunctions Get-Setting Get-Version Invoke-Clean New-NugetPackage Set-Version Test-Pester Update-PublicFunctions

Dependencies

This module has no dependencies.

Release Notes

## [0.2.0-ci0014] - 2021-04-07
### New Features
- ✨ Better Release Notes Headers (#7)  
   Headers updated to include the version and follow Keep-A-Changelog format. Sort Order implemented to put higher importance items to the top.
- ✨ Improve Public Function Matching (#6)  
   Public Function detection now allows for private helper functions specific to that public function to be included in the same file without being exported out of the module.
- ✨ Add Release Notes Generation (#3)  
   Release notes are now generated using keep-a-changelog format and saved as markdown to BuildOutput folder as well as updating the releasenotes property of the .psd1
- ✨ Incremental Build Support (#1)  
   Added support for incremental builds where tasks that do not have updated data do not run.  
   Initial Github Actions Support also added.

### Minor Updates and Bug Fixes
- 🐛Replace Update-ModuleManifest with Update-Metadata due to bug (#5)  
   Update-ModuleManifest messed up private data per PowerShell/PowerShellGetv2#294, so we use Update-Metadata instead.
- ✏️ Remove incorrect filename capitalization
- 🐛 Better Release Notes Comparison (#4)  
   * Better Release Notes Comparison (newline formatting sometimes gets lost when setting to manifest)  
   * Make Moduleversion explicitly null
- 📝 Gitversion Gitmoji Updates
- 👷 Capture PSModule as Artifact
- 👷 Github Actions Initial Config
- 📝 Add Project Note
- 📝 Add License and Readme

### Other
- fixup! Test Powershell Gallery Deploy
- Test Powershell Gallery Deploy

FileList

Version History

Version Downloads Last updated
0.3.1 268 8/21/2021
0.3.1-beta0001 12 8/21/2021
0.3.0-beta0033 65 6/9/2021
0.3.0-beta0032 10 6/8/2021
0.3.0-beta0031 10 6/8/2021
0.3.0-beta0030 121 6/8/2021
0.3.0-beta0029 10 6/8/2021
0.3.0-beta0028 10 6/8/2021
0.3.0-beta0027 17 5/28/2021
0.3.0-beta0026 10 5/27/2021
0.3.0-beta0025 18 5/26/2021
0.3.0-beta0024 10 5/26/2021
0.3.0-beta0023 10 5/26/2021
0.3.0-beta0022 10 5/26/2021
0.3.0-beta0021 10 5/25/2021
0.3.0-beta0020 11 5/21/2021
0.3.0-beta0019 10 5/21/2021
0.3.0-beta0018 11 5/19/2021
0.2.4-beta0013 14 5/12/2021
0.2.4-beta0012 12 5/12/2021
0.2.4-beta0011 12 5/12/2021
0.2.4-beta0010 12 5/3/2021
0.2.4-beta0009 60 4/14/2021
0.2.4-beta0008 12 4/14/2021
0.2.4-beta0007 11 4/14/2021
0.2.4-beta0006 42 4/14/2021
0.2.4-beta0005 12 4/14/2021
0.2.4-beta0004 14 4/14/2021
0.2.4-beta0003 13 4/13/2021
0.2.4-beta0002 11 4/13/2021
0.2.4-beta0001 11 4/13/2021
0.2.3 55 4/13/2021
0.2.3-beta0001 10 4/13/2021
0.2.2 14 4/13/2021
0.2.2-beta0001 10 4/13/2021
Show less